New Wii System Update Allows Play Right from SD Cards!
Friday, April 3rd, 2009At the GDC2009, Satoru Iwata gave a keynote speech, and talked about the new Wii system update. This new update allows players to download from the Wii Shop Channel directly to an SD card – and play the games right off the card.
I found information about the new update on the Wii system memory Wikipedia page – it’s version 4.0:
- Update includes SD Card Menu to “move” files and channels between the Wii console and SD card
- You can download and play Virtual Console or WiiWare games directly to the SD card from the Wii Shop Channel
- Wii Shop Channel supports classic arcade games
- Ability to save and access Wii Channels from the SD card
- SDHC card (up to 32 GB) support for System Menu, Wii Speak Channel, Shop Channel, and Photo Channel. Other features may not support SDHC cards.
- Deletes every version of the Twilight Hack (including 0.1beta2)
- Patches IOS16, which was the last official IOS with the signing bug
- Fixed the bug that was used in the Homebrew Channel installer (so all existing IOS-versions were updated)
- Added IOS38, IOS53, IOS55, IOS60, and IOS61
Right now, version 4.0 supports SD memory cards of up to 32GB! Have you updated lately?
